Indian Rattlebox Crotalaria assamica
Prices start at : 4.95 USD / 1 packet

* Crotalarias are grown in the tropics as green manure cover crops due to their nitrogen fixing capabilities and drought tolerance. * They are occationally grown as ornamentals for their yellow flowers and interesting rattling seed pods.

Spiny Saltbush, Shadscale Atriplex confertifolia
Prices start at : 3.95 USD / 1 packet

* The seed is used in pinole or ground into a meal and used as a thickener in making bread or mixed with flour in making bread. * The leaves are cooked and used as greens. The water in which the leaves are cooked is used in making corn pudding .
